LOADING...
LOADING...
LOADING...
当前位置: 玩币族首页 > 区块链资讯 > QKFile是通用目的的基础架构

QKFile是通用目的的基础架构

2020-02-22 财神圈Tow 来源:区块链网络

分布式存储是区块链公司正在研究和实施的潜在解决方案。 它是一个能够存储文件的系统,无需回复大量集中的数据孤岛,这些数据孤岛不会破坏隐私和信息自由等重要价值。

IPFS + FileCoin

星际文件系统(IPFS)是Protocol Labs发起的一种协议,是用于在Web上创建服务器信息的新方法。 目前,互联网运作的位置基于类似于您访问像media.com这样的IP,其IP为XXXX,然后您就可以获得文章的地方。 这些URL指向世界各地的某些服务器(美国,新加坡,英国等)。

相反,IPFS所做的是它根据内容而不是信息(位置)来提供信息。 通过他们的路由算法,您可以选择从哪里获取内容,并且可以设置您信任的同伴/节点的隐私,以接收您的文件,这非常有趣。 那有什么好处呢?

· 通过从多个节点和片段而不是从一个服务器收集内容来节省带宽

· 访问内容“离线”或在低连接性第三世界或农村地区,与git离线工作的意义相同。

· 审查抵制

· 与去中心化的精神契合

QKFile从根本上改变了查找的方式,这是它最重要的特征。使用HTTP我们查找的是位置,而使用QKFile我们查找的是内容。举个例子:服务器上运行着一个文件https://neocities.org/img/neocitieslogo.svg,遵照HTTP协议浏览器首先会查找服务器的位置(IP地址),随后向服务器索要文件的路径。这种体系下文件的位置取决于服务器管理者,而用户只能寄希望于文件没有被移动,并且服务器没有关闭。QKFile的做法则是不再关心中心服务器的位置,也不考虑文件的名字和路径,只关注文件中可能出现的内容。把刚才的文件neocitieslogo.svg放到QKFile节点,它会得到一个新名字QmXGTaGWTT1uUtfSb2sBAvArMEVLK4rQEcQg5bv7wwdzwU,是一个由文件内容计算出的加密哈希值。哈希值直接反映文件的内容,哪怕只修改1比特,哈希值也会完全不同。

当QKFile被请求一个文件哈希时,它会使用一个分布式哈希表找到文件所在的节点,取回文件并验证文件数据。虽然早期的分布式哈希表曾遭受过女巫攻击,但是已经有一些新的方案来实现。

QKFile是通用目的的基础架构,基本没有存储上的限制。大文件会被切分成小的分块,下载的时候可以从多个服务器同时获取。QKFile的网络是不固定的、细粒度的、分布式的网络,可以很好的适应内容分发网络(CDM)的要求。这样的设计可以很好的共享各类数据,包括图像、视频流、分布式数据库、整个操作系统、模块链、8英寸软盘的备份,还有最重要的--静态网站。

—-

编译者/作者:财神圈Tow

玩币族申明:玩币族作为开放的资讯翻译/分享平台,所提供的所有资讯仅代表作者个人观点,与玩币族平台立场无关,且不构成任何投资理财建议。文章版权归原作者所有。

LOADING...
LOADING...